Allison Saft's romantic fantasy, "A Fragile Enchantment," weaves magic into the fabric of a royal wedding. Niamh Ó Conchobhair, a gifted dressmaker with a fatal magic, seizes the opportunity to secure her family's future by designing for Avaland's royal wedding.
Expecting a fairytale, Niamh discovers a kingdom in turmoil. The groom, Kit Carmine, faces political pressure, and Niamh finds herself entangled in scandal due to their undeniable chemistry. Amidst societal unrest, a forbidden friendship blossoms into love, prompting a gossip columnist to exploit their connection.
As Niamh and Kit grapple with their feelings, an anonymous figure threatens to expose Avaland's royal secrets. Unraveling the kingdom's corruption may jeopardize the future Niamh never dared dream of and a love she deemed impossible.
Set in a Regency England-inspired fantasy realm, "A Fragile Enchantment" invites readers into a world of magic, intrigue, and timeless romance.
